St Aidan’s Church of England High School is seeking to appoint a highly organised and enthusiastic Design & Technology Technician to support our successful and well-resourced Art and Technology faculty, with a focus on Product Design and Engineering.
This is an exciting opportunity to play a vital role supporting teaching and learning by preparing materials, maintaining equipment, and helping to create a safe, engaging workshop environment for students.
You will be practical, organised, and detail-oriented, with a proactive, flexible, and hard-working approach. You will have experience of, or a strong interest in, working in a technical or workshop environment and a good understanding of materials, tools, and processes. You will be aware of health and safety requirements, with knowledge of COSHH being desirable, and you will be confident using workshop machinery, with CAD/CAM experience considered an advantage.

Safeguarding
St Aidan’s Church of England High School (Part of YCST) takes safeguarding very seriously and is committed to safeguarding and the promotion of the welfare of all children and the prevention of extremism. We expect all staff and volunteers to share this commitment.
Successful applicants will be required to provide references, undertake an enhanced check through the Disclosure and Barring Service and comply with the Safeguarding Policy and Child Protection Practices of YCST. Checks are also undertaken to verify identity, address, qualifications required for the post, right to work in the UK and previous employment history.
